Definition:

Melancholic sound refers to a musical tone or composition that evokes a sense of deep sadness, sorrow, or emotional introspection. It often incorporates minor keys, slow tempos, and poignant lyrics or melodies that resonate with feelings of longing, nostalgia, or despair. This type of sound can create a profound emotional impact on listeners, eliciting a range of introspective and contemplative responses. Melancholic sound is often associated with genres such as indie, alternative, and certain sub-genres of rock and electronic music.


Melancholic sound is characterized by its ability to convey complex emotions and evoke a deep sense of empathy and connection with the listener. It has the power to transport individuals to a reflective state, prompting them to explore their own emotions and experiences through the music's evocative qualities.

Context:

The context of melancholic sound is often found in artistic expressions, including music, film scores, and poetry. It is frequently utilized to convey a specific mood or atmosphere within creative works, adding depth and emotional resonance to the overall narrative. In the music industry, artists and composers intentionally incorporate melancholic sound to create a profound impact on their audience, aiming to evoke a range of emotions and foster a deep connection with their listeners.


Melancholic sound is also prevalent in therapeutic settings, where it can be used to facilitate emotional processing and introspection. Additionally, it is often featured in media productions to underscore poignant moments, adding a layer of emotional depth and resonance to visual storytelling.


Comparative Analysis:

In comparison to other musical tones, melancholic sound stands out for its ability to evoke profound emotional responses and create a sense of introspection and empathy. While joyful and upbeat music may inspire feelings of happiness and excitement, melancholic sound delves into the complexities of human emotions, offering a deeper and more contemplative experience for the listener.


When compared to other emotional tones in music, such as uplifting or serene compositions, melancholic sound sets itself apart by delving into themes of loss, longing, and emotional turmoil. It provides a unique platform for artists and composers to convey raw and vulnerable emotions, resonating with audiences on a deeply personal level.

FAQs

What are some popular examples of artists known for their melancholic sound?

Some popular artists known for their melancholic sound include Bon Iver, Radiohead, Lana Del Rey, The National, and Sigur R��s.
